Health Benefits of Mangoes: Vitamins, Antioxidants, and More


Mangoes, often referred to as the “king of fruits,” are not only delicious but also packed with numerous health benefits. This tropical fruit is a powerhouse of essential vitamins, antioxidants, and minerals that can contribute significantly to your overall well-being. From boosting your immune system to enhancing your skin health, mangoes offer a variety of advantages that make them an excellent addition to your diet. In this blog, we will explore the incredible health benefits of mangoes and how they can positively impact your life.

Rich in vitamins A, C, and E, mangoes are a potent source of antioxidants that help protect your body from harmful free radicals. Vitamin A supports eye health, ensuring good vision and reducing the risk of macular degeneration. Vitamin C boosts your immune system, aids in collagen production, and promotes healthy skin. Additionally, vitamin E acts as a powerful antioxidant that helps maintain youthful skin and reduces inflammation. Beyond these vitamins, mangoes contain a range of other nutrients, including fiber, potassium, and folate, which contribute to heart health, digestion, and overall vitality.
